Subject: [for-next][PATCH 02/12] tools/bootconfig: Add a summary of test cases and return error

From: Masami Hiramatsu <mhiramat@kernel.org>

Add summary lines of test cases and return an error
code if any test case fails so that tester don't have
to monitor the output.

 tools/bootconfig/test-bootconfig.sh | 7 +++++++
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+)

diff --git a/tools/bootconfig/test-bootconfig.sh b/tools/bootconfig/test-bootconfig.sh
index 81b350ffd03f..eff16b77d5eb 100755
--- a/tools/bootconfig/test-bootconfig.sh
+++ b/tools/bootconfig/test-bootconfig.sh
@@ -124,9 +124,16 @@ for i in samples/good-* ; do
   xpass $BOOTCONF -a $i $INITRD
 done
 
+
+echo
+echo "=== Summary ==="
+echo "# of Passed: $(expr $NO - $NG - 1)"
+echo "# of Failed: $NG"
+
 echo
 if [ $NG -eq 0 ]; then
 	echo "All tests passed"
 else
 	echo "$NG tests failed"
+	exit 1
 fi
